How do large molecules move across the plasma membrane

Biology
2 answers:
Elodia [21]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

The plasma membrane is selectively permeable

Explanation:

hydrophobic molecules and small polar molecules can diffuse through the lipid layer, but ions and large polar molecules cannot. Integral membrane proteins enable ions and large polar molecules to pass through the membrane by passive or active transport.

Amenorrhea may occur among women at fat levels as high as:
Sophie [7]
The correct answer is "16%"

16% of body fat in women is considered as low as normal body fat levels in women normally ranges from 22% to 25%. In cases of low body fat levels (i.e. in athletic women), there will be relative amenorrhea because of the suppression of the follicle-stimulating hormone and the luteinizing hormone leading to a type of amenorrhea called athletic amenorrhea.
